From Kalamazoo, Mich.: The NCAA has decided that the outcome of a game between Michigan and Western Michigan will stand. The Mid-American Conference had appealed, citing an extraordinary circumstance and asking that Western Michigan be recognized as the winner. The appeal was made to the NCAA and College Football Playoff administrators.

The result of the game has significant financial implications, particularly with regards to the College Football Playoff bracket selection in December.
